'/classes/Memcached_DataObject.php'; /** * Data class for counting greetings * * We use the DB_DataObject framework for data classes in StatusNet. Each * table maps to a particular data class, making it easier to manipulate * data. * * Data classes should extend Memcached_DataObject, the (slightly misnamed) * extension of DB_DataObject that provides caching, internationalization, * and other bits of good functionality to StatusNet-specific data classes. * * @category Action * @package StatusNet * @author Evan Prodromou * @license http://www.fsf.org/licensing/licenses/agpl.html AGPLv3 * @link http://status.net/ * * @see DB_DataObject */ class User_greeting_count extends Memcached_DataObject { public $__table = 'user_greeting_count'; // table name public $user_id; // int(4) primary_key not_null public $greeting_count; // int(4) /** * Get an instance by key * * This is a utility method to get a single instance with a given key value. * * @param string $k Key to use to lookup (usually 'user_id' for this class) * @param mixed $v Value to lookup * * @return User_greeting_count object found, or null for no hits * */ function staticGet($k, $v=null) { return Memcached_DataObject::staticGet('User_greeting_count', $k, $v); } /** * return table definition for DB_DataObject * * DB_DataObject needs to know something about the table to manipulate * instances. This method provides all the DB_DataObject needs to know. * * @return array array of column definitions */ function table() { return array('user_id' => DB_DATAOBJECT_INT + DB_DATAOBJECT_NOTNULL, 'greeting_count' => DB_DATAOBJECT_INT); } /** * return key definitions for DB_DataObject * * DB_DataObject needs to know about keys that the table has, since it * won't appear in StatusNet's own keys list. In most cases, this will * simply reference your keyTypes() function. * * @return array list of key field names */ function keys() { return array_keys($this->keyTypes()); } /** * return key definitions for Memcached_DataObject * * Our caching system uses the same key definitions, but uses a different * method to get them. This key information is used to store and clear * cached data, so be sure to list any key that will be used for static * lookups. * * @return array associative array of key definitions, field name to type: * 'K' for primary key: for compound keys, add an entry for each component; * 'U' for unique keys: compound keys are not well supported here. */ function keyTypes() { return array('user_id' => 'K'); } /** * Magic formula for non-autoincrementing integer primary keys * * If a table has a single integer column as its primary key, DB_DataObject * assumes that the column is auto-incrementing and makes a sequence table * to do this incrementation. Since we don't need this for our class, we * overload this method and return the magic formula that DB_DataObject needs. * * @return array magic three-false array that stops auto-incrementing. */ function sequenceKey() { return array(false, false, false); } /** * Increment a user's greeting count and return instance * * This method handles the ins and outs of creating a new greeting_count for a * user or fetching the existing greeting count and incrementing its value. * * @param integer $user_id ID of the user to get a count for * * @return User_greeting_count instance for this user, with count already incremented. */ static function inc($user_id) { $gc = User_greeting_count::staticGet('user_id', $user_id); if (empty($gc)) { $gc = new User_greeting_count(); $gc->user_id = $user_id; $gc->greeting_count = 1; $result = $gc->insert(); if (!$result) { // TRANS: Exception thrown when the user greeting count could not be saved in the database. // TRANS: %d is a user ID (number). throw Exception(sprintf(_m("Could not save new greeting count for %d."), $user_id)); } } else { $orig = clone($gc); $gc->greeting_count++; $result = $gc->update($orig); if (!$result) { // TRANS: Exception thrown when the user greeting count could not be saved in the database. // TRANS: %d is a user ID (number). throw Exception(sprintf(_m("Could not increment greeting count for %d."), $user_id)); } } return $gc; } }
